Output 189d4598c8f2e0fb5d07a7de61bbdf24496459270b3293c440e2b5e9202de055:3

value
28889497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a28a73a2fc33f7e5b568903735027e822e60243 OP_EQUAL
address
MPQsogF4bBHRaWKu1L9xTCD8Aaw3aJXvhg
transaction
189d4598c8f2e0fb5d07a7de61bbdf24496459270b3293c440e2b5e9202de055
spent
true